Notre Dame Clinches Victory Over Penn State with Last-Minute Field Goal

In a thrilling matchup, Notre Dame edged out Penn State with a nail-biting 27-24 victory, thanks to a clutch 41-yard field goal by Mitch Jeter with just eight seconds remaining on the clock. The game was a rollercoaster of emotions, with both teams showcasing their skills and determination throughout the contest.

Notre Dame started strong, establishing an early lead, but Penn State fought back fiercely, demonstrating resilience and tactical prowess. As the game progressed, the tension built, with both offenses and defenses trading blows. The crowd was on the edge of their seats as the clock wound down, and it became clear that the game would come down to the final moments.

With the score tied and time running out, Jeter stepped up to the challenge, delivering a perfectly executed kick that sailed through the uprights, sealing the victory for Notre Dame. This win not only boosts Notre Dame's season but also sets the stage for an exciting finish as they continue their pursuit of a playoff spot.
